The Story of the City Hall Commission: Including the Exercises at the Laying of the Corner Stones

In this fascinating historical account, Prentiss Webster tells the story of the creation of the iconic City Hall in Philadelphia. Through detailed descriptions of the building process and insightful analysis of the political and social forces that shaped the project, Webster offers a compelling portrait of one of America's greatest architectural achievements. A must-read for anyone interested in the history of American architecture or urban planning.
